Explore this Property

This beautiful, brick colonial was tastefully remodeled and is ready for a new owner to call it their home. Conveniently located just outside of Akron University, this home is a great opportunity for a student-housing rental. The spacious backyard is fenced in and offers ample entertainment space. On the third floor, you have a large room that could be used for additional living or as a fourth bedroom. There's nothing else needed on the home but to move in! Hurry, this one won't last long.

Demographic facts
for Akron, OH 44310

Akron, OH 44310 has a population of 24,324 people in 9,463 households with a median age of 35.8 years old.
